[Guide] Setting up a Monero full node on Tails

When should you use this guide Connecting to a third party remote node is not an option (threat model, agency, etc.) You are not able to host a private .onion remote node outside of Tails (with e.g. PiNode-XMR ) Running Qubes+Whonix is not an option This guide does not require setting up a root password or making changes to the firewall. For instructions on how to set up a wallet on Tails with a remote node, visit: http://xmrguide42y34onq.onion/tails What you will need 1 SSF USB (Tails+Blockchain) OR a regular USB (Tails) + external SSD (Blockchain) Corsair Flash Voyager GTX (CMFVYGTX3C-128GB) Sandisk Extreme PRO (SDCZ880-128G-G46) Samsung Portable SSD T5 A computer with at least 4 GB of RAM and an USB 3.0 port Some technical competence The device that stores the blockchain should have a capacity of at least 100 GB. Using the specs above and a recent processor syncing will take on the order of 15 - 30 hours. This will work with regular USB flash storage, but...
